文摘AIM:To evaluate the utility of diffusion-weighted im-aging(DWI)in screening and differential diagnosis of benign and malignant focal hepatic lesions.METHODS:Magnetic resonance imaging(MRI)ex-aminations were performed using the Signa Excite Xl Twin Speed 1.5T system(GE Healthcare,Milwaukee,WI,USA).Seventy patients who had undergone MRI of the liver [29 hepatocellular carcinomas(HCC),four cholangiocarcinomas,34 metastatic liver cancers,10 hemangiomas,and eight cysts] between April 2004 and August 2008 were retrospectively evaluated.Visu-alization of lesions,relative contrast ratio(RCR),and apparent diffusion coefficient(ADC)were compared between benign and malignant lesions on DWI.Su-perparamagnetic iron oxide(SPIO)was administered to 59 patients,and RCR was compared pre-and post-administration.RESULTS:DWI showed higher contrast between ma-lignant lesions(especially in multiple small metastatic cancers)and surrounding liver parenchyma than did contrast-enhanced computed tomography.ADCs(mean ± SD × 10-3 mm2/s)were signif icantly lower(P < 0.05)in malignant lesions(HCC:1.31 ± 0.28 and liver me-tastasis:1.11 ± 0.22)and were signifi cantly higher in benign lesions(hemangioma:1.84 ± 0.37 and cyst:2.61 ± 0.45)than in the surrounding hepatic tissues.RCR between malignant lesions and surrounding he-patic tissues signifi cantly improved after SPIO adminis-tration,but RCRs in benign lesions were not improved.CONCLUSION:DWI is a simple and sensitive method for screening focal hepatic lesions and is useful for dif-ferential diagnosis.

文摘BACKGROUND Sedation is commonly performed for the endoscopic submucosal dissection(ESD)of early gastric cancer.Severe hypoxemia occasionally occurs due to the respiratory depression during sedation.AIM To establish predictive models for respiratory depression during sedation for ESD.METHODS Thirty-five adult patients undergoing sedation using propofol and pentazocine for gastric ESDs participated in this prospective observational study.Preoperatively,a portable sleep monitor and STOP questionnaires,which are the established screening tools for sleep apnea syndrome,were utilized.Respiration during sedation was assessed by a standard polysomnography technique including the pulse oximeter,nasal pressure sensor,nasal thermistor sensor,and chest and abdominal respiratory motion sensors.The apnea-hypopnea index(AHI)was obtained using a preoperative portable sleep monitor and polysomnography during ESD.A predictive model for the AHI during sedation was developed using either the preoperative AHI or STOP questionnaire score.RESULTS All ESDs were completed successfully and without complications.Seventeen patients(49%)had a preoperative AHI greater than 5/h.The intraoperative AHI was significantly greater than the preoperative AHI(12.8±7.6 events/h vs 9.35±11.0 events/h,P=0.049).Among the potential predictive variables,age,body mass index,STOP questionnaire score,and preoperative AHI were significantly correlated with AHI during sedation.Multiple linear regression analysis determined either STOP questionnaire score or preoperative AHI as independent predictors for intraoperative AHI≥30/h(area under the curve[AUC]:0.707 and 0.833,respectively)and AHI between 15 and 30/h(AUC:0.761 and 0.778,respectively).CONCLUSION The cost-effective STOP questionnaire shows performance for predicting abnormal breathing during sedation for ESD that was equivalent to that of preoperative portable sleep monitoring.

文摘BACKGROUND The role of the hepatic nervous system in liver development remains unclear.We previously created functional human micro-hepatic tissue in mice by co-culturing human hepatic endodermal cells with endothelial and mesenchymal cells.However,they lacked Glisson’s sheath[the portal tract(PT)].The PT consists of branches of the hepatic artery(HA),portal vein,and intrahepatic bile duct(IHBD),collectively called the portal triad,together with autonomic nerves.AIM To evaluate the development of the mouse hepatic nervous network in the PT using immunohistochemistry.METHODS Liver samples from C57BL/6J mice were harvested at different developmental time periods,from embryonic day(E)10.5 to postnatal day(P)56.Thin sections of the surface cut through the hepatic hilus were examined using protein gene product 9.5(PGP9.5)and cytokeratin 19(CK19)antibodies,markers of nerve fibers(NFs),and biliary epithelial cells(BECs),respectively.The numbers of NFs and IHBDs were separately counted in a PT around the hepatic hilus(center)and the peripheral area(periphery)of the liver,comparing the average values between the center and the periphery at each developmental stage.NF-IHBD and NF-HA contacts in a PT were counted,and their relationship was quantified.SRYrelated high mobility group-box gene 9(SOX9),another BEC marker;hepatocyte nuclear factor 4α(HNF4α),a marker of hepatocytes;and Jagged-1,a Notch ligand,were also immunostained to observe the PT development.RESULTS HNF4αwas expressed in the nucleus,and Jagged-1 was diffusely positive in the primitive liver at E10.5;however,the PGP9.5 and CK19 were negative in the fetal liver.SOX9-positive cells were scattered in the periportal area in the liver at E12.5.The Jagged-1 was mainly expressed in the periportal tissue,and the number of SOX9-positive cells increased at E16.5.SOX9-positive cells constructed the ductal plate and primitive IHBDs mainly at the center,and SOX-9-positive IHBDs partly acquired CK19 positivity at the same period.PGP9.5-positive bodies were first found at E16.5 and HAs were first found at P0 in the periportal tissue of the center.Therefore,primitive PT structures were first constructed at P0 in the center.Along with remodeling of the periportal tissue,the number of CK19-positive IHBDs and PGP9.5-positive NFs gradually increased,and PTs were also formed in the periphery until P5.The numbers of NFs and IHBDs were significantly higher in the center than in the periphery from E16.5 to P5.The numbers of NFs and IHBDs reached the adult level at P28,with decreased differences between the center and periphery.NFs associated more frequently with HAs than IHBDs in PTs at the early phase after birth,after which the number of NF-IHBD contacts gradually increased.CONCLUSION Mouse hepatic NFs first emerge at the center just before birth and extend toward the periphery.The interaction between NFs and IHBDs or HAs plays important roles in the morphogenesis of PT structure.

文摘Robot-assisted laparoscopic radical prostatectomy(RARP)is widely used to treat prostate cancer.The rigid instruments primarily used in RARP cannot overcome the problem of blind areas in surgery and lead to more trauma such as more incision for the passage of the instrument and additional tissue damage caused by rigid instruments.Soft robots are relatively fexible and theoretically have infinite degrees of freedom which can overcome the problem of the rigid instrument.A soft robot system for single-port transvesical robot-assisted radical prostatectomy(STvRARP)is developed in this study.The soft manipulator with 10 mm in diameter and a maximum bending angle of 270°has good fexibility and dexterity.The design and mechanical structure of the soft robot are described.The kinematics of the soft manipulator is established and the inverse kinematics is compensated based on the characteristics of the designed soft manipulator.The master-slave control system of soft robot for surgery is built and the feasibility of the designed soft robot is verified.
